About Shelby, OH
Shelby is a small community in Ohio with a population of 8,706 residents. The median household income is $52,760 per year, which is near the national average. The median age in Shelby is 40.5 years.
Housing in Shelby has a median home value of $117,300 and median monthly rent of $724. Of the 3,943 total housing units, the majority are owner-occupied, with 2,321 owner-occupied and 1,311 renter-occupied units.
The unemployment rate in Shelby is 3.9% and the poverty rate is 13.7%. 15.2%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The average commute time is 21.3 minutes.
Cost of Living in Shelby, OH
Compared to national averages, Shelby has a median household income of $52,760 (30% below the national median of $75,149). Home values average $117,300, which is 52% below the national median. Monthly rent at $724 is 38% below the US average of $1,163. Within Ohio, Shelby's income is 27% below the state average of $71,814, and home values are 33% below the state median of $174,449.
